How much does it cost to rent a home in Keystone?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Keystone 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$916 | $600 | $1,270 |
Keystone 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,657 | $1,200 | $2,200 |
Keystone 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,608 | $1,425 | $1,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Keystone
What type of rentals are currently available in Keystone?
There are currently 39 Apartments for Rent in Keystone, IA with pricing that ranges from $555 to $97,500. There are also 35 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Keystone ranging from $500 to $2,200.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Keystone?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Keystone ranges from $500 to $2,200 with an average monthly rent of $1,103.
